Best Bath Public Schools (2025-26)

For the 2025-26 school year, there are 2 public schools serving 778 students in Bath, PA (there are , serving 96 private students). 89% of all K-12 students in Bath, PA are educated in public schools (compared to the PA state average of 86%).
The top-ranked public schools in Bath, PA are Moore Elementary School and George Wolf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Bath, PA public schools have an average math proficiency score of 51% (versus the Pennsylvania public school average of 38%), and reading proficiency score of 61% (versus the 55% statewide average). Schools in Bath have an average ranking of 7/10, which is in the top 50% of Pennsylvania public schools.
Minority enrollment is 16%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Pennsylvania public school average of 39% (majority Hispanic and Black).
